THE MAGNIFICENT DEFEAT
A Contemplative Retreat for Men

 

May 30 - June 2, 2013
Thursday 6:00 pm (dinner) to
Sunday (lunch)

 

$290 Overnight (includes all meals)
Register before May 24, 2013

Come join us – a bond of brothers willing to risk the journey into greater wholeness and holiness. Holiness does not refer to being "perfect" or otherworldly. It refers to being completely and authentically who we were created to be – fully human and fully alive. Men who realize that this adventure of life was never meant to be traveled alone. Men who long to know God and know the true gift of themselves. A life-giving gift worthy of offering for the healing of the world. The world is dying for the gift of such men.

This retreat will be a guided contemplative pilgrimage of the soul. It is not for the weak-of-heart or spiritual voyeurs. It is for men who want to engage in the process of spiritual transformation. It is an invitation to discover a Love that refuses to let us remain less than who we were created to be – "the full reflection of God as only we [sic] can be". A Love that is willing to risk our defeat in order to offer us our true self and God's true self.

The patriarch Jacob will be our guide on this pilgrimage of becoming more.

Retreat will include

  •  Guided meditation/prayer time
  •  Small group interaction
  •  Large group discussions

RETREAT LEADER

Don Ferris is a self-described exotic car enthusiast, lover of ice cream, New York style cheesecake, Chicago style pizza, Philadelphia cheese steaks. Loves having fun, travel, adventure, reading, and movies. A minister for 43 years. Co-founder and co-director of Eagle's Wings Ministries, a contemplative retreat ministry, he is a Mercy Center-trained spiritual director and facilitator of the 19th annotation of the Spiritual Exercises of St. Ignatius. Don is passionate about pursuing a life fully human and fully alive and inviting others to the adventure.
